How to Choose Environmentally Responsible Gear

  1. Check for certified recycled or upcycled materials.
  2. Prioritize brands with transparent supply chains and published impact reports.
  3. Look for repair programmes and gear longevity guarantees.
  4. Support modular gear (replace parts, not entire system).

How Often Should You Replace Gear?

Replace heavily used shoes after 600–800 km, sleeping pads every 3–5 years (with repair as needed), and hydration filters every 12 months or after 1000L filtered. Most packs now last 8+ years based on lab durability cycles and field-reviewed longevity.
